Perl match not case sensitive
WebAug 2, 2010 · If you want the actual "eq" operator to be case insensitive, it might be possible using overloads but I don't think that's what you are asking for - please clarify your … WebCaseless matching with perl = TRUE for non-ASCII characters depends on the PCRE library being compiled with ‘Unicode property support’, which PCRE2 is by default. Value grep (value = FALSE) returns a vector of the indices of the elements of x that yielded a …
Perl match not case sensitive
Did you know?
WebTo instruct Perl to match a pattern case insensitive, you need to add a modifier i as the following example: #!/usr/bin/perl use warnings; use strict; my $s = "Regular expression" ; … WebCase-insensitive string contains, in Perl Programming-Idioms Perl Idiom #133 Case-insensitive string contains Set boolean ok to true if string word is contained in string s as a substring, even if the case doesn't match, or to false otherwise. C++ C# C# D Dart Elixir Go Rust Perl my $ok = $s =~ /\Q$word/i; Doc C++ C# C# D Dart Elixir Erlang Fortran
Webknowing Perl Regular Expressions (RegEx) will help anyone implement complex pattern matching and ... OO matches the characters OO literally (case sensitive) [0-9]{3} o 0-9 a single character in the range between 0 and 9 ... Flags /i modifier makes matching case-insensitive . 6 SAS PRX Functions Learning RegExing in SAS, the first thing a ... WebApr 4, 2024 · x: It is a character vector where matches are sought, or an object which can be coerced by as.character to a character vector. ignore.case: If FALSE, the pattern matching is case sensitive, and if TRUE, the case is ignored during matching. perl: It is a logical argument and should Perl-compatible regular expressions be used.
WebMay 9, 2012 · The proper solution for normalized comparisons is to perform casefolding instead of mapping a subset of some characters to another. Perl 5.16 added a new … WebThe match operator supports its own set of modifiers. The /g modifier allows for global matching. The /i modifier will make the match case insensitive. Here is the complete list of modifiers Matching Only Once There is also a simpler version of the match operator - the ?PATTERN? operator.
WebPerl Matching Operator =~ The matching operator =~ is used to match a word in the given string. It is case sensitive, means if string has a lowercase letter and you are searching for an uppercase letter then it will not match. $line = "This is javaTpoint."; if ($line =~ /java/) { print "Matching\n"; }else { print "Not Matching\n"; }
WebApr 8, 2024 · The syntax is pretty simple sed -i 's/SEARCH-WORD/REPLACMENT-WORD/gi' input The -i option edit and update file in place. The BSD implementation of sed does NOT support case-insensitive matching Please note that macOS comes with BSD version of sed which does not support case-insensitive matching. fort wayne indiana flower deliveryWebHere are the string operators together with the numerical operators they correspond too: Notice that the string operators are built from the initials of their abbreviated names. (E.g: … fort wayne indiana fireworksWebIdiom #133 Case-insensitive string contains. Set boolean ok to true if string word is contained in string s as a substring, even if the case doesn't match, or to false otherwise. … dior waterproof foundationWeb#The (~) after the location tag specifies it is case sensitive # so it overrides the next rule, which would continuously redirect location ~ /index[.]html { #process the index.html page … fort wayne indiana flagWebSynopsis. The Perl regular expression syntax is based on that used by the programming language Perl . Perl regular expressions are the default behavior in Boost.Regex or you can pass the flag perl to the basic_regex constructor, for example: // e1 is a case sensitive Perl regular expression: // since Perl is the default option there's no need ... dior weightless foundationWebApr 8, 2024 · The BSD implementation of sed does NOT support case-insensitive matching. Please note that macOS comes with BSD version of sed which does not support case … fort wayne indiana fire departmentWebMay 2, 2024 · The s/// substitution command in Perl (and thus in the Perl rename command) has a flag /i to do case insensitive match. All you need to do is perl-rename -n 's/b (\d … fort wayne indiana flea markets